Output 088e7915d0ab49f30689d75a52f66d8db2939024a27831f012f6618d7b488f01:0

value
1948664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cf6a603e78fc2c1d5b52d1ed75d83f3cf8046cc OP_EQUALVERIFY OP_CHECKSIG
address
1DrM5J4wdWa5C8inEepqeMSDMYF4MNAK6F
transaction
088e7915d0ab49f30689d75a52f66d8db2939024a27831f012f6618d7b488f01
confirmations
449627
spent
true